<br />, <br /> <br />. <br />, <br /> <br />ATTACHMENT 4 <br /> <br />e <br /> <br />FPR 98-482 <br />Draft Floodplain Information Report, Town of Fleming, Logan County, <br />Colorado, January, 1999, including Flood Hazard Boundary Map, Town of <br />Fleming, Colorado, Logan County, dated November 8, 1974 <br /> <br />KEY ISSUES: <br />. The FIR, including the 1974 FHBM contains approximate floodplain information for two <br />streams within the Town of Fleming, Wildhorse Creek and a small tributary. <br /> <br />. By a letter dated July 15, 1985 FEMA rescinded the FHBM, finding that there was no <br />significant flood hazard within the town. <br /> <br />. In 1996 and 1997 Fleming experienced flooding on Wildhorse Creek. The flooding in 1997 <br />affected several residential buildings along the creek. Based on information gathered so far, it <br />is clear that there are 100-year floodplains within the town that should be mapped and then <br />designated by the CWCB, which contradicts FEMA's 1985 fmding. <br /> <br />. At a meeting in Fleming on January 5, 1999 the town requested that CWCB staff help the town <br />determine whether the approximate floodplain delineations shown on the 1974 FHBM are <br />reasonable. CWCB staff agreed to work with the town to make the requested determination by e <br />March 31,1999. <br /> <br />. The CWCB will use an approximate 100-year flow for Wildhorse Creek and field-surveyed <br />cross-sections in a 3-block area of Fleming to estimate flood depths and floodplain widths in <br />the vicinity of the houses that experienced flooding in 1997. Those hydraulic estimates and the <br />documentation of the historic floods will be compared to the 1974 FHBM to advise the town <br />about the reasonableness of the FHBM and to make appropriate revisions. <br /> <br />COMMUNITY RESPONSE: <br />The Town of Fleming requested that CWCB staff attend a Town Board meeting to discuss <br />the proposed designation action with the Town Board and affected residents before they <br />would consider sending a letter requesting any CWCB designation action. The meeting was <br />held on January 5, 1995, and CWCB staff agreed to help the town with a hydraulic <br />evaluation of the FHBM. No letter will be sent by the town until the evaluation is finished. <br /> <br />SUMMARY: <br />The staff recommends that the Board table the proposed resolution until the Town of Fleming is <br />satisfied with the CWCB staff s hydraulic analysis of the reasonableness of the current floodplain <br />information (as shown on the 1974 FHBM). The staff has arranged to work with the town to <br />review historic documentation of recent floods and to perform approximate hydraulic analyses at <br />selected cross-sections along Wildhorse Creek where it flooded existing residential buildings. e <br /> <br />6 <br />
